Important topics to prepare for SBI PO 2018 EXAM



SBI PO 2018 exam will be conducted in the month of August 2018. It has three sections in the Phase 1 of the exam namely, Reasoning, Quantitative Aptitude and English Language. These subjects have got various topics to be studied before appearing in the exam to get a reasonable score to ace the exam. It has mainly three phases to qualify these are:
a.       Preliminary Exam
b.       Mains Exam and
c.       The Interview Process
Since preliminary exam is round the corner, let us discuss some important topics to be studied for the three sections.

After cracking preliminary and mains there comes the third and final phase of Interview. After the interview, final merit list will be prepared on the basis of performance in the respective phases.
Tips to prepare section – wise are:

a. Quantitative Aptitude:

  • Study all mathematical formulae
  • Practice Previous years questions
  • Practice mock Tests regularly

b. English Language:

  • develop in areas like one-word substitution, phrase replacement, idioms and phrases, synonyms and antonyms
  • study books on various grammar rules followed by the practice exercise
  • Practice at length to get better in the language
  • Download apps like Dictionary.com and Oxford English Dictionary to discover new words
  • Solve Mock Tests

c. General Awareness:

  • General Knowledge should be learned by reading and is a very scoring section
  • Buy renowned book on General Knowledge books for reference
  • Learn all important subjects like banking awareness, history, geography, political science, economics, computer, etc
  • Daily revise the current affairs that have taken place in the last 6-12 months.
  • Current affairs section can be organized with the help of newspapers, news apps or books

d. Reasoning:

·   Practice quizzes based on the topics given such as Classification, Analogy, Coding-Decoding, Puzzles, Matrix, Word Formation, Arranging Words in Dictionary Order or Meaningful order, Venn Diagram, Direction and Distances, Series, Non-Verbal Reasoning, Verbal Reasoning.
·        Refer previous year question papers to practice more on the topics to know the latest exam pattern.
These are the important topics and tips to follow to study subject-wise and you must give equal time to all the sections to get a high score. Higher the score better are the chances of getting a joining as SBI PO.
